Tb1Tl1Ag2 is an intermetallic compound combining terbium (rare earth), thallium, and silver elements in a defined stoichiometric ratio. This is a research-phase material rather than an established commercial semiconductor, studied primarily for its electronic and structural properties within the rare-earth intermetallic family. The combination of rare earth and precious metal constituents suggests potential interest in specialized optoelectronic, photonic, or high-performance electronic applications, though engineering adoption would require further development and cost-benefit validation against conventional semiconductors.
